We just received a call that mom was found on the floor in her apartment bleeding from her head. My family and I have tried calling back the facility several times, letting the phone ring for 5 minutes straight and NO ONE answered. This is a repeat occurrence but now we're really unhappy. I think there is one person at night currently for an entire assisted living AND memory care facility due to turnover of staff A nurse is on call at night but not on site. Starting to realize this is a mistake. The grounds are beautiful but the caregiver to resident ratio is not enough.

Overall, I think it's a very nice facility, I think the care is okay, it's hard for me to really assess because I'm not there very often. I can say that she gets her medcation very well everyday, but I don't know how frequently the nursing staff or the doctor sees her. When I ask my sister, the kind of answers I'm getting from her aren't very clear. She's a very private person and very selective on what she does. She had been in a place in New York before so she had the experience of what a facility is like and I think this facility is superior from a phsyical standpoint. The building is beauitful, well maintained, the activities they have are quite comparable to what they had in New York, she would say "they're all the same" but she's quite ciritcal. I don't think I could satisfy her wherever I put her, I'm never going to get her to say "this is wonderful," but as far as I'm concerned, you can't get a better value in this area.

A Place for Mom has scored Commonwealth Senior Living at Haddam 7 out of 10 using our proprietary review score.
We assign review scores to give a more reliable view into senior living communities and home care agencies. Our review scores prioritize reviews that are recent — the past 24 months — because we know families need current information when choosing senior care.
Those with many recent, positive reviews receive a high review score, while providers with few recent reviews — regardless of how positive — receive a lower review score. Communities with no recent reviews will not have a review score, even if older reviews are positive. The maximum A Place for Mom review score a community can receive is 10 points.
